The combination of aerodrome control and radar has been done for years (probably over a decade) outside of the UK. If it works there, why not in the UK?

Not directly related to TBS, but I think if the safety case has been proven in practice for years outside the UK and approved byt he CAA, then it can be considered to be acceptable.

So you have one concept which was proven before it was brought in the UK, still there are many doubting wether it will work.

Then you have a concept (TBS) which has been designed from scratch, within the UK, and still the same doubts arise?

To very different developments met with the same response, what did they both do wrong in order to get that response?
